After reading some of the comments left on other travel websites,( mainly by Canadians ) we were a bit apprehensive about what to expect from Beaches Hotel. Thankfully, we were pleasantly suprised at both the quality of the hotel and most of all by the friendly staff and we had a brilliant time there! The All-Inclusive rules in Cuba and you could literally stay here and spend no money and still have a great time. The bars were well stocked with all drinks, spirits and beer but I would really urge you to get hold of those thermal travel mugs as they were worth their weight in gold, keeping the cold drinks nice and cold, also around the pools, they only use plastic cups so you'll save yourself keep walking up to the bar. Go to Cuba with an open mind, but don't judge it against Jamaica or Cancun, because the Cubans can't compete because of the trade embargo. They make the best of what they have got and they do it very well. |
